    Comments Thread For: Teofimo Lopez: I'll Fight Crawford at Catchweight, Keyshawn Davis Hasn't Done Anything!

    Teofimo Lopez (20-1, 13 KOs) defended his WBO and Ring Magazine junior welterweight world titles with a unanimous decision win over Jamaine Ortiz (17-2-1, 8 KOs) Thursday evening at Michelob ULTRA Arena at Mandalay Bay Resort and Casino in Las Vegas.
